Min Chang Oh is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cell Biology and Biochem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Min Chang Oh has authored 12 papers receiving a total of 366 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Molecular Biology, 6 papers in Cell Biology and 4 papers in Biochemistry. Recurrent topics in Min Chang Oh's work include Genomics, phytochemicals, and oxidative stress (4 papers), Phytochemicals and Antioxidant Activities (4 papers) and melanin and skin pigmentation (3 papers). Min Chang Oh is often cited by papers focused on Genomics, phytochemicals, and oxidative stress (4 papers), Phytochemicals and Antioxidant Activities (4 papers) and melanin and skin pigmentation (3 papers). Min Chang Oh collaborates with scholars based in South Korea and China. Min Chang Oh's co-authors include Jin Won Hyun, Mei Jing Piao, Kyoung Ah Kang, Yea Seong Ryu, Xia Han, Susara Ruwan Kumara Madduma Hewage, Uhee Jung, In Gyu Kim, Jeong Eon Park and Sungwook Chae and has published in prestigious journals such as Environmental Toxicology and Pharmacology, Tumor Biology and Molecular Medicine Reports.
